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 30213
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en 30213?
Actualmente hay 37 Apartamentos Estudios en 30213 con alquileres que van desde $829 hasta $1,531, con un precio medio de $1,113.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 30213?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 30213 varian entre $665 y $3,948 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,486
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 30213?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 30213 van desde $784 hasta $7,152.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,674
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 30213?
En estos momentos hay 76 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 30213 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$889 y $4,724 - con una media de $2,239 para el lugar.
